Если вы хотите создать бота в Яндексе, но не знаете с чего начать, то эта статья поможет вам разобраться в процессе!
Создание бота в Яндексе - это отличный способ автоматизировать свои задачи, улучшить коммуникацию с клиентами или просто поразвлечься. Правда, создание бота может показаться сложным делом для новичков, но не беспокойтесь - мы предоставим вам подробную инструкцию, которая поможет вам шаг за шагом создать своего собственного бота!
Прежде чем начать, убедитесь, что у вас есть аккаунт разработчика в Яндексе. Если у вас его нет, вам необходимо зарегистрироваться на сайте Яндекса и создать новый аккаунт разработчика.
Первым шагом будет создание нового навыка в Яндекс.Диалогах. Навык - это то, что будет выполнять ваш бот. Чтобы создать навык, вам нужно зайти в раздел "Навыки" на сайте Яндекс.Диалогов и нажать на кнопку "Создать новый навык". Затем выберите платформу, на которой будет работать ваш бот - в данном случае выберите "Яндекс.Диалоги".
Как создать бота в Яндексе
Яндекс предлагает простой и удобный способ создания ботов, которые могут общаться с пользователями в различных мессенджерах. Создание бота в Яндексе предполагает использование сервиса "Диалоги", который предоставляет готовые инструменты для разработки и настройки бота. В этой статье мы рассмотрим пошаговую инструкцию по созданию бота в Яндексе.
- Зарегистрируйтесь на сайте Яндекс (если у вас нет аккаунта).
- Перейдите на страницу "Диалоги" в Яндексе.
- Нажмите на кнопку "Создать навык" и выберите тип навыка, который вы хотите создать.
- Введите название и описание бота.
- Настройте параметры навыка, включая его иконку, цветовую схему и другие опции.
- Создайте или импортируйте сценарий для бота. Сценарий задает поведение и функциональность бота.
- Настройте данные входящих и исходящих сообщений бота.
- Запустите бота и протестируйте его работу.
После создания и настройки бота, вы можете добавить его в различные мессенджеры, такие как Яндекс.Алиса, ВКонтакте или Telegram, чтобы пользователи могли общаться с ним. Создание бота в Яндексе – это увлекательный и полезный опыт, открывающий двери к мирту возможностей в области разработки ботов и искусственного интеллекта.
Подробная инструкция для новичков
Создание бота в Яндексе может показаться сложным процессом для новичков, но следуя данной подробной инструкции, вы сможете справиться с задачей легко и быстро.
- Зарегистрируйтесь на сайте Яндекса, если у вас еще нет аккаунта. Для этого перейдите на главную страницу Яндекса и нажмите на кнопку "Создать аккаунт". Введите необходимые данные и следуйте указаниям системы.
- Зайдите в раздел "Яндекс.Диалоги". Для этого нажмите на значок "Диалоги" в верхнем меню Яндекса или воспользуйтесь прямой ссылкой: https://dialogs.yandex.ru/
- Нажмите на кнопку "Создать диалог" и выберите тип диалога - "Диалоговое приложение".
- Заполните основные данные для диалога. Укажите его название, категорию, язык и выберите иконку. Нажмите кнопку "Сохранить".
- Перейдите в раздел "Сценарий". Здесь вы можете настроить логику работы бота, добавить вопросы и ответы на них.
- По желанию, вы можете задать критерии для активации диалога, например, указать ключевые слова, по которым бот будет реагировать.
- Для создания ответов бота можете использовать готовые шаблоны или написать свои собственные тексты. Ответы можно разделить на несколько вариантов, чтобы бот мог выбирать наиболее подходящий ответ.
- После настройки сценария, сохраните его и перейдите в раздел "Тестирование". Тут вы можете протестировать работу бота, задавая ему различные вопросы и проверяя его ответы.
- Если бот работает корректно и отвечает на вопросы правильно, вы можете перейти в раздел "Публикация". Здесь укажите данные для публикации бота, выберите его доступность для всех пользователей или только для себя.
- После публикации бота, вы можете поделиться ссылкой на него с другими пользователями или интегрировать его в свой сайт или приложение.
Теперь, следуя этой подробной инструкции, вы можете создать собственного бота в Яндексе без особых проблем. Удачи!
Выбор платформы
Перед тем как начать создавать бота в Яндексе, важно определиться с платформой, на которой будет работать ваш бот. В настоящее время существуют несколько популярных платформ для создания чат-ботов:
- Яндекс.Диалоги - это платформа от Яндекса, которая предоставляет возможность создавать и запускать ботов в приложениях и сервисах Яндекса;
- Telegram - популярный мессенджер, который также поддерживает создание и запуск чат-ботов;
- VKontakte (VK) - популярная социальная сеть, которая также предоставляет возможность создать своего бота.
Каждая платформа имеет свои особенности и возможности, поэтому выбор зависит от того, где вы хотите запустить бота и какие функции он должен выполнять. Рекомендуется ознакомиться с документацией каждой платформы, чтобы сделать правильный выбор.
Если вы новичок в создании чат-ботов, то рекомендуется начать с платформы Яндекс.Диалоги, так как она предоставляет достаточно простой интерфейс и множество готовых инструментов для создания ботов.
Однако, если у вас уже есть опыт работы с Telegram или VK, то вы можете выбрать соответствующую платформу для создания бота.
Определите цель и функциональность бота
Перед тем, как начать создание бота в Яндексе, необходимо определить его цель и функциональность. Четкое понимание задачи, которую бот будет выполнять, поможет вам правильно настроить его функции и обеспечить эффективную работу.
Цель бота может быть разной в зависимости от потребностей и задач вашего проекта. Например, вы можете создать бота для предоставления информации о вашей компании или продукте, для обработки заказов или бронирований, для ответа на часто задаваемые вопросы пользователей или для улучшения взаимодействия с вашими клиентами.
Функциональность бота должна быть направлена на эффективное выполнение его задачи. Определите, какие возможности и функции должен иметь ваш бот для достижения поставленной цели. Например, это может быть предоставление информации, обработка запросов и отзывов, генерация отчетов, интеграция с другими сервисами или системами.
Также стоит учесть, что функциональность бота может различаться в зависимости от платформы, на которой он будет работать. Например, для бота в Яндексе можно использовать такие функции, как мультиплатформенность, работа с голосовыми командами, интеграция с сервисами Яндекса и другими популярными приложениями.
Важно провести анализ потребностей пользователя, чтобы определить функционал бота, который будет наиболее полезен и удобен для его использования. Рассмотрите, какие вопросы и запросы пользователи могут задавать, а также какие действия и задачи они могут хотеть выполнить с помощью бота.
Итак, определение цели и функциональности бота является важным шагом перед его созданием. Четкое понимание того, что должен делать бот и как он будет это делать, поможет вам создать эффективного помощника, способного удовлетворить потребности ваших пользователей.
Создание диалоговой модели
Перед тем, как приступить к созданию бота в Яндексе, необходимо разработать диалоговую модель. Диалоговая модель определяет структуру бота, его функциональные возможности и взаимодействие с пользователями. В данном разделе мы рассмотрим основные шаги создания диалоговой модели.
1. Определите цель бота и его задачи. Подумайте, какую ценность ваш бот сможет предоставить пользователям и какие возможности он будет иметь.
2. Создайте список ключевых фраз и вопросов, которые пользователи могут задать боту. Важно учесть самые популярные вопросы и запросы, чтобы ваш бот мог на них отвечать.
3. Разделите ключевые фразы по тематикам и создайте список интентов. Интенты представляют собой намерения пользователя - что он хочет узнать или сделать через бота. Интенты помогут вашему боту определить, какую информацию нужно предоставить пользователю в ответ.
4. Для каждого интента создайте список вопросов, которые может задать пользователь. Подумайте, какие варианты формулировок могут использоваться и добавьте их в список.
5. Определите возможные ответы на каждый вопрос. Создайте список фраз или блоков текста, которые ваш бот может использовать в качестве ответа. Обратите внимание на разнообразие формулировок и вариантов ответа, чтобы бот не отвечал однообразно.
6. Создайте дерево диалога. На основе списка интентов, вопросов и ответов создайте структуру диалога. Определите последовательность вопросов и ответов, которые бот будет предоставлять в зависимости от ситуации.
7. Импортируйте диалоговую модель в Яндекс.Dialogs. После того, как диалоговая модель готова, вам необходимо импортировать ее в сервис Яндекс.Dialogs. Здесь вы сможете настроить дополнительные параметры, включая стартовое сообщение, кнопки и возможность сохранения контекста диалога.
Важно помнить, что создание диалоговой модели - это итеративный процесс. Не бойтесь экспериментировать, тестировать и улучшать вашего бота на основе обратной связи от пользователей.
Определите шаги диалога
Подумайте о том, какие вопросы хотите задать пользователю и какие ответы ожидаете получить. Например, вы можете начать с приветствия и спросить имя пользователя. Затем можете задать следующий вопрос, основанный на ответе пользователя, и так далее.
Важно учесть возможные варианты ответов пользователя и предусмотреть соответствующую реакцию бота на каждый из них. Например, если бот задает вопрос о предпочитаемом цвете, возможны ответы "синий", "красный" и "зеленый". Вам нужно настроить бота таким образом, чтобы он понимал эти ответы и отвечал соответствующим образом.
Определите логику диалога, чтобы бот мог вести разговор с пользователем естественным образом и предлагать ему полезную информацию или помощь в решении задач.
Постепенно создавайте шаги диалога, добавляя новые вопросы и ответы, пока не получите готовую последовательность. Не забывайте тестировать бота и вносить изменения при необходимости.